Analysis
The most recent figure for number of births, by world region in Croatia is 31,446 births, measured in 2023. That is the lowest value across all 74 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 4.8% on the previous year and down 20.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, number of births, by world region in Croatia peaked at 97,115 births in 1950 and was at its lowest, 31,446 births, in 2023.
That places Croatia 144th out of 236 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 74 years of available data.
